Thesis (M.S.W.)--California State University, Long Beach, 2006.
This study examined differences among older ethnic groups regarding the ability to perform basic and instrumental activities of daily living and levels of depression. Relationships between these variables were examined within each group separately. In addition, the effects of other sociodemographic variables were examined.

Respondents consisted of 562 frail older adults who participated in the Kaiser Permanente Community Partners research study. The sample consisted of 355 European Americans, 112 African Americans, and 95 Hispanic Americans.

Results showed that each ethnic group exhibited moderate levels of depression, with Hispanic Americans having significantly higher mean scores than African Americans. In terms of gender, African American women reported significantly higher levels of depression than African American men. There were no gender differences found among European Americans and Hispanic Americans. For the total sample, functional limitations were correlated with higher levels of depression. However, when analyzed within each ethnic group, results were mixed. For European Americans and African Americans, lower functional status was found to be significantly associated with higher depression levels. These results were not found among Hispanic Americans. Finally, while controlling for sociodemographic variables, income was also found to have a causal relationship as a predictor of depression.

These findings suggest that there is a need for further research in the area of minority aging and health. In addition, the need for culturally sensitive programs to address depression in older adulthood is warranted.
